The City of Savannah is committed to developing our future automotive mechanic workforce. We support a progressive trainee program that will prepare you to become a certified automotive mechanic while working in our Fleet Services facility. 

As an Automotive Services Mechanic A, you will be responsible for the repair and maintenance of City vehicles and equipment. This is the advanced journey-level classification in the series. Employees in this role serve as lead technicians and subject matter experts for the repair and maintenance of complex vehicle and equipment systems. Work involves in-depth diagnostics, rebuilding of major components, troubleshooting advanced electronic and multiplex systems, and performing field repairs under minimal supervision.

Examples of duties


  • Diagnose and repair electronic engines, heavy equipment, specialized equipment, electronic transmissions, anti-lock braking systems, electrical systems, multiplex systems, air conditioning and heating systems, steering systems, fuel systems, and suspensions.
  • Rebuild and repair fire pump transmissions, fire truck valves, water pumps, transfer cases, differentials, brakes, power steering boxes, and engines.
  • Prioritize and schedule maintenance tasks.
  • Open, close, and update work orders.
  • Ensure all repairs are performed to specifications.
  • Assist others with complex repairs and diagnostics.
  • Read and interpret repair manuals and schematics.
  • Perform field service calls.
  • Conduct failure analysis and perform tire repairs.
  • Train other personnel.
  • Perform minor welding and parts fabrication.
  • Adhere to all safety guidelines.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.

Qualifications

High school diploma or GED with a minimum of six months of vocational training in automotive/vehicle mechanics and engine repair.
Three years of experience in vehicle and equipment repair and maintenance.
Must possess and maintain a valid state Commercial Driver's License with an acceptable driving history or must obtain CDL within six months of employment.

Must hold at least four (4) ASE certifications.

Knowledge, Skills & Abilities
Knowledge of shop safety guidelines.
Knowledge of the repair and maintenance of City vehicles and equipment.
Knowledge of techniques, practices, procedures, test equipment, and documentation used in all aspects of maintenance for automotive vehicles, trucks, fire apparatus, and other fleet equipment.
Skill in diagnosing and repairing equipment failures.
Skill in establishing priorities and organizing work.
Skill in the use of hand and power tools.
Skill in the interpretation of manuals and schematics.
Skill in oral and written communication.
